RESOLUTION

NO.







WHEREAS, during his distinguished career, the Reverend Dr. J.H. Flakes, Jr. has

made significant contributions to the Columbus, Georgia community;



WHEREAS, Rev. Flakes received a Bachelor of Arts degree from American Baptist

College in Nashville, Tennessee and honorary Doctorate degrees from A.B. Lee

Theological Seminary in Jacksonville, Florida and from American Baptist College;



WHEREAS, he has been a recipient of the Alpha Phi Alpha Martin Luther King

Award, the Knighthood Award from the Congress of Christian Education, and has

been recognized as one of the Ten Outstanding Ministers in the State of Georgia;



WHEREAS, Rev. Flakes has served as Moderator of the East Alabama Missionary

Baptist Progressive Association, Lecture for Moderator?s Division, Teacher in

the Minister?s Division, and on the Executive Committee Board of the National

Baptist Convention;



WHEREAS, he is Chairman of the Board of Trustees of American Baptist College,

Chairman of One Columbus, and founder of ?A Call To Talk?;



WHEREAS, Rev. Flakes was recently recognized when the Administration Building

at the American Baptist Training School in Nashville, Tennessee was named in

his honor;



WHEREAS, Rev. Flakes has traveled extensively abroad, including the

Philippines, Japan, Thailand, Hong Kong, India, Egypt, the former Soviet Union,

Africa, Germany, Italy and the Holy Land;



WHEREAS, Rev. Flakes has been married to the lovely Robena Gaines Flakes for

fifty-seven years and is the father of three children and grandfather of three

granddaughters;



WHEREAS, the Columbus Council wishes to honor the occasion of the 50th

Anniversary of Rev. Flakes? ministry at Fourth Street Baptist Church of

Columbus, Georgia.



NOW THEREFORE THE COUNCIL OF COLUMBUS, GEORGIA HEREBY RESOLVES:



In honor of Reverend Dr. J.H. Flakes, Jr. and his devotion to Columbus,

Georgia and its citizens, the street known as 5th Street in Columbus, Georgia

is hereby designated ?Rev. J.H. Flakes, Jr. Way,? in its entirety. This

honorary designation shall not change the official street map, but the Traffic

Engineer is hereby authorized to erect appropriate signage in a color

distinguishable from standard street signage. Let a copy of this Resolution to

Reverend Doctor J.H. Flakes, Jr.
